Project introduces Avalanche’s curating ecosystem like Pinterest for Web3.

P2E (play-to-earn) through AXS (Axie Infinity) and its offshoot M2E (move-to-earn) gaming have been rising throughout 2021 through the channel STEPN (GMT). Now another earning through game model has been launched to take advantage of Web3 elements. It plans to use current Web2 frameworks. The CurateDAO team announced the launching of a database platform like Pinterest. It will be available on the blockchain network Avalanche (AVAX). Users will earn rewards in the form of crypto tokens when they perform tasks.

A variety of roles will be available in the ecosystem of the project. The participants will include the curators who can mint. They can also set database rules. A scout will be a part of this project as well. The task for the scout will be to find and submit content that meet the rules of the database. Even viewers who check the content and participate will be part of this ecosystem.

The curator in it can be any individual, a DAO (decentralized autonomous organization), or an AI (artificial intelligence) program such as GPT-3. All of them including the scouts will earn as viewers purchase the content, or access it after viewing the advertisements.

The CurateDAO team thinks the incentives for curation will help gather the best quality data. CurateDAO founder Michael Fischer said the project can be used to acquire content generated by users in the same way it works with Web2 applications.
